Cafe Poca Cosa Description:
Ah, the magic that is Café Poca Cosa. With its ever-changing menu, a dedication to using market-fresh ingredients and creative inspirations from chef and owner Suzana Davila, Café Poca Cosa shouldn't be missed. It's a beautifully dressed restaurant that serves first-rate Mexican food that's clever without being coy, modern yet deeply traditional and savory with a hint of sweetness. The servers describe the food in such tasty detail that you may find it tough to choose. Make it easy on yourself, and pick the plato Poca Cosa, a three-item combination plate of Davila's choosing. Chicken, beef, pork and fish all play central roles, but under Davila's guidance, the beef could be slow-cooked in a savory sauce sweetened with just a tad of plum, or a tender chicken breast could be stewed in a tomato cream sauce. Poca Cosa is known for its mole sauces, richly layered flavors of chocolate, peanuts, coffee liquor and other savory ingredients. Every meal comes with a salad, rice, beans and tortillas to share.
